Sarah Kuras

Sarah Kuras has followed her lifelong passion for music through her studies at Binghamton University, where she completed her BA in Philosophy, Politics and Law and a minor in Music in 2011 and her Master’s in Business Administration in 2012. At Binghamton University, she studied viola with Roberta Crawford and voice with Amanda Chmela, and performed with the Symphony Orchestra, Women’s Chorus, Harpur Chorale, the Nukporfe African Music Ensemble, and made guest appearances with the rock band, The Fine Line.

At Binghamton University, Ms. Kuras was a member of WHRW 90.5 FM, where she served as the Director of Public Affairs and hosted a weekly radio show playing Caribbean music and music of the African Diaspora.

Following internships in development at performing arts organizations Caramoor Center for Music and the Arts in Katonah, NY, and Southern Tier Celebrates!, in Binghamton, NY, Ms. Kuras worked at the Binghamton University Center for Civic Engagement. She currently works in Development at an East Harlem non-profit.

Ms. Kuras was initiated into the Zeta Eta Chapter at Binghamton where she served as Secretary and Inter-Chapter Relations Officer. She joined the New York City Alumni Chapter in 2012.
